ideal for exam use -- clear easy-to-read text The palgrave macmillan core statutes series has been developed to meet the needs of today's law students. Compiled by experienced lecturers, each title contains the essential materials needed at LLB level and, where applicable, on GDL/CPE courses. They are specifically designed to be easy to use under exam conditions and in the lecture hall. This first edition of core documents in international law contains essential material up to June 2010. This collection includes: * the principal international organisation agreements * treaty law, statehood, state responsibility and immunities * the key United Nations human rights treaties * environmental law instruments including the UNFCCC and Kyoto Protocol * use of force and the main international criminal law documents * law of the sea and outer space "This accessible collection brings together the essential international law documents that students need at a very reasonable price."
